Must See Concert: Friends At Bowery Ballroom, July 6th, 2012

Far be it for me to thank Rolling Stone for anything, but I have to give em props for introducing me to Brooklyn five piece indie dance rock band Friends. The first line of Will Hermes review of their debut album Manifest quotes their song "Sorry": "Ethically it's pretty fucked, I want you to come over to my house". Well, you have to have more willpower than I do not to want to stop your life and check em out.

The album is good, the song is awesome and Samantha Urbani is soooo hip (check the video below of her getting a lap dance) and cool that she is One Direction's resident bad boy Zayn Malik's girlfriend.  Which makes her the envy of half the girls in the US of A.

The band have a vibe that money can't buy, a vibe of a band that can go pop no problem and that when they do will start the process of transforming cool: like, er, Blondie did in the 1970s!!! Their videos are a blast, especially the one for "Mind Control". It is kinda interesting how fame transform somebodies appearance without changing anything about them. It is as if popularity makes them more exciting, more beautiful. Samantha looks hotter with every passing day.

Friends are the band of the summer and their concert at Bowery Ballroom on a Saturday July 4th week, is the gig of the season. I wish the album sustained the sexy come on of "Sorry" but give it time and it might revea itself more.
